WebIn the Heisenberg picture, the states do not depend on time but the op-erators do depend on time. A Heisenberg operator O(t) is related to the corresponding Schr¨odinger operator O S by O(t) = e iHtO S e − (4) Thus hψ O(t) ψi = Shψ(t) O S ψ(t)i S. WebJun 15, 2024 · The Heisenberg Picture's treatment of time already meshes quite well with General Relativity's treatment of time. In particular, the Heisenberg equations when generalized to fields, become partial differential equations whose forms do not single out any dimension of spacetime. They treat time and space on an equal footing.
